Operation Transformation is back on RTÉ One at 9:35pm tonight. 
Operation Transformation

Glanmire native, Tanya Carroll, was the final leader to be revealed for the RTÉ One show after previously announced leader Claire Beakhurst was forced to pull out due to medical reasons. 

Tanya, 33 is the mother of four children and has a hectic schedule as RTÉ states:

"Obsessed with Coca Cola, Tanya says she's been heavy for years, but the weight really came on after she gave up smoking. 

"On a given day, she says, she'll drink between six and eight cans of the soft drink and starts her day with that and coffee.

"As a busy mum and carer for her elderly dad, who has diabetes and is also overweight, Tanya has a lot on her plate. 

"Her family struggles to talk about weight with her, while her husband is upset by her low self-esteem."

Tanya joins two other participants as the three Cork leaders in the show this year.

Husband and wife duo Andrea and Barry Rea are to make history as the first couple ever to take part in the show.

The two who hail from Ballinlough will act as separate leaders as they work hard to develop healthier lifestyles.

Scientist Andrea, 31 applied first, having watched OT over the years. 

When she told her husband Barry, a physiotherapist, he also decided to apply.

Barry turns 40 in July 2020, and at just over 29st, this is the heaviest he has been.

There could be a healthy dose of competition between the newlyweds as RTÉ states:

"[Andrea] worries about what will happen if they both have a bad day together. 

"On the flip side, they are both competitive which will definitely help to keep them both on track."

Kathryn Thomas will once again present Operation Transformation joined by four experts, Karl Henry, fitness expert; Dr Eddie Murphy, a principal clinical psychologist with the HSE; Aoife Hearne, a registered dietitian; and Healthy Ireland Council member and GP Dr Sumi Dunne.
